Pros
- Offers convenient morning automation with programmable timers.
- Provides good value for money, ranging from budget-friendly to high-end.
- Consistent brew quality is achievable with SCA-certified models.
- Generally easy to clean and operate.
Cons
- Entry-level models may have plastic construction or lack premium features like SCA certification.
- Glass carafes can be fragile if handled carelessly.
- Hot plate warming can degrade coffee flavor if left too long.
- Some budget models may struggle to hit optimal brewing temperatures.
